Water consumption is divided into two types, one is nominal water consumption which refers to the nominal volume of water used by the product, and the other is the actual water consumption which refers to the measured average water consumption by the product.
In this paper, water consumption refers to the nominal water consumption.
Water shortage and water pollution are worldwide environment problems, and the water crisis has severely restricted human sustainable development.
Fresh water consumption refers to the amount of water from various water sources that the enterprise needs in the production of unit product.

Approximately 40% of planned low-emission hydrogen projects are in water-stressed regions, prompting developers to explore desalination and wastewater recycling to ensure a sufficient water supply [1,3].
Green hydrogen is produced solely through water electrolysis, which splits water molecules into hydrogen and oxygen using electricity from a renewable energy source.

As highly porous material it can absorb water and release it slowly into the soil.
Gas formation can be achieved via expulsion of hydration water from clay minerals or via decomposition or reduction of inorganic salts and oxides.
